NAZWA¶
wcsncasecmp - porównuje dwa łańcuchy szerokich znaków o
ustalonej długości, ignorując wielkość liter
SKŁADNIA¶
#include <wchar.h>
int wcsncasecmp(const wchar_t *s1, const wchar_t *s2, size_t n);
OPIS¶
Uwaga! To tłumaczenie może być nieaktualne!
Funkcja
wcsncasecmp jest szerokoznakowym odpowiednikiem funkcji
strncasecmp(3). Porównuje ona łańcuch szerokich
znaków, wskazywanym przez
s1 z łańcuchem szerokich
znaków, wskazywanym przez
s2. szerokich znaków z każdego
łańcucha.
WARTOŚĆ ZWRACANA¶
Funkcja
wcsncasecmp zwraca zero jeśli po przycięciu do
n
znaków, łańcuchy
s1 i
s2 są jednakowe (poza
różnicami w rozmiarach liter). Zwraca też wartość
dodatnią, gdy przycięty
s1 jest większy od
przyciętego
s2 (z ignorowaniem rozmiarów liter).
Wartość ujemna zwracana jest gdy przycięty
s1 jest
mniejszy od przyciętego
s2 (z ignorowaniem rozmiarów liter).
ZGODNE Z¶
Ta funkcja jest rozszerzeniem GNU.
ZOBACZ TAKŻE¶
strncasecmp(3),
wcsncmp(3)
UWAGI¶
Zachowanie funkcji
wcsncasecmp zależy od kategorii LC_CTYPE
bieżących ustawień locale.
Powyższe tłumaczenie pochodzi z nieistniejącego już Projektu
Tłumaczenia Manuali i
może nie być aktualne. W razie
zauważenia różnic między powyższym opisem a
rzeczywistym zachowaniem opisywanego programu lub funkcji, prosimy o
zapoznanie się z oryginalną (angielską) wersją strony
podręcznika za pomocą polecenia:
- man --locale=C 3 wcsncasecmp
Prosimy o pomoc w aktualizacji stron man - więcej informacji można
znaleźć pod adresem
http://sourceforge.net/projects/manpages-pl/.